How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Medford?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Medford Studio Apartments | $2,200 | $1,850 | $2,604 |
| South Medford 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,759 | $2,050 | $4,175 |
| South Medford 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,150 | $1,900 | $5,950 |
| South Medford 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,619 | $2,800 | $5,295 |
| South Medford 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,586 | $3,000 | $6,500 |
| South Medford 5 Bedroom Apartments | $6,220 | $1,200 | $7,995 |
| South Medford 6 Bedroom Apartments | $7,865 | $6,500 | $10,000+ |
